About K. Akioka

K. Akioka is a scholar working on Electronic, Optical and Magnetic Materials, Surfaces, Coatings and Films and Radiation, having authored 33 papers that have together received 373 indexed citations. Recurring topics across this work include Magnetic Properties of Alloys (14 papers), Organic and Molecular Conductors Research (9 papers) and Superconducting Materials and Applications (8 papers). The work is most often cited by research in Electronic, Optical and Magnetic Materials (271 citations), Condensed Matter Physics (111 citations) and General Materials Science (19 citations). K. Akioka has collaborated with scholars based in Japan, Germany and United States. Frequent co-authors include Tatsuya Shimoda, Osamu Kobayashi, Hitoshi Ohta, Shojiro Kimura, Takafumi Yamada, Yoshinori Yamamoto, Susumu Okubo, M. Motokawa, Kazushi Kanoda and Kouichi Tsuji. Their work appears in journals such as Journal of Applied Physics, Journal of Magnetism and Magnetic Materials and IEEE Transactions on Magnetics.
